Modern industrial gold mining destroys landscapes and creates huge amounts of toxic waste. Due to the use of dirty practices such as open pit mining and cyanide heap leaching, mining companies generate about 20 tons of toxic waste for every gold ring. The waste, usually a gray liquid sludge, is laden with deadly cyanide and toxic heavy metals.

The mining industry of Cyprus was active in the production of minerals of copper, iron pyrite, gold, chromites as well as asbestos fibers. Since 1979 the mining industry of Cyprus is in recession because of the exhaustion of the known large and rich copper and iron pyrite ore bodies and the increase of the production cost without proportional increase in the international sale .

Diamond and, in particular, gold mining industries required an enormous amount of inexpensive labour in order to be profitable. To constrain the ability of African workers to bargain up their wages, and to ensure that they put up with strenuous employment conditions, the British in the 1870s and 1880s conquered the stillindependent African states in southern Africa, .
Development of a mining industry. Most of the gold won in the 1860s was found in rich, surface gravels, and was worked by individuals or small groups using simple equipment. The richer and most accessible ground was quickly exhausted, and largerscale mining started in the 1870s. Alluvial gold was sluiced and dredged, and hardrock gold and coal were worked in .
